Job summary
A research laboratory is seeking undergraduate student interns to support SONAR technology projects. The internship involves tasks like piezoelectric material processing, transducer modeling, and acoustic testing. Candidates will work up to 20 hours per week during the academic semesters and may work full-time in summer. Applicants must be U.S. citizens and will be subject to background checks. This is a paid position located in Freeport, Pennsylvania.
